Speaker Circuit (to 12/2010)





NAVIGATION: NAVIGATION SYSTEM: Speaker Circuit
- Speaker Circuit

DESCRIPTION

The sound signals amplified by the stereo component amplifier assembly are sent to the speakers from the stereo component amplifier assembly through this circuit.

If there is a short in this circuit, the stereo component amplifier assembly detects it and stops output to the speakers.

Thus sound cannot be heard from the speakers even if there is no malfunction in the stereo component amplifier assembly or speakers.

If a short is detected in the speaker circuit, no sound can be heard from the speakers.

INSPECTION PROCEDURE

PROCEDURE

1. CHECK HARNESS AND CONNECTOR

(a) Disconnect the E36 stereo component amplifier assembly connector.

(b) Disconnect the E37 stereo component amplifier assembly connector.

(c) Disconnect the E38 stereo component amplifier assembly connector.

(d) Disconnect the H3 and G3 front No. 1 speaker connectors.

(e) Disconnect the D1 and D43 front No. 2 speaker connectors.

(f) Disconnect the F3 front No. 3 speaker connector.

(g) Disconnect the J3 and I3 rear speaker connectors.

(h) Disconnect the J6 and I6 rear No. 2 speaker connectors.

(i) Disconnect the L15 and L13 roof speaker connectors.

(j) Disconnect the L24 rear stereo component speaker connector.

(k) Measure the resistance between each of the front No. 2 speakers and the stereo component amplifier assembly to check for an open circuit in the wire harness.
